What is recorded here
Probably part of Glib Water. Excavations in 1996 showed that it was cut into boulder clay, replaced by a stone-lined channel, slightly re-aligned in c. 1600 (Gowen 1997, 32). Partly extant below ground level in 2002 (Clarke 2002, 26).
